### ESP32 IO
| Signal | ESP32 Pin | Description |
|-----------|-----------|---------------------|
| FAN_TACH | GPIO4 | Fan Speed output |
| TEMP_ALRT | GPIO9 | NCT218 Alert output |
| SCL | GPIO18 | I2C Clock (NCT218) |
| SDA | GPIO19 | I2C Data (NCT218) |
| RX | GPIO2 | BM1397 RO |
| TX | GPIO3 | BM1397 CI |
| RST | GPIO10 | BM1397 NRSTI |
## Goals ## Goals
- Develop some firmware for the ESP32 to connect to a stratum server/pool over WiFi and get work for the mining ASIC - Develop some firmware for the ESP32 to connect to a stratum server/pool over WiFi and get work for the mining ASIC
- Firmware should monitor fan speed - Firmware should monitor fan speed
- Firmware should monitor BM1397 core temperature (via NCT218) - Firmware should monitor BM1397 core temperature (via NCT218)
- Firmware should tune each BM1397 by adjusting it's core voltage - Firmware should tune each BM1397 by adjusting it's core voltage
- Put a high current, low voltage buck regulator on the board that the ESP32 can adjust the voltage of. - Put a high current, low voltage buck regulator on the board that the ESP32 can adjust the voltage of.
